For the weekly sync: the Streamlace gateway team is evaluating per-message websocket compression. Compression cuts bandwidth roughly 60% on Plover dashboard payloads, but adds measurable CPU cost per frame and complicates our memory budgeting under high fan-out. We recommend enabling it only for payloads above 1 KB and keeping the context-takeover window small. The full benchmark data and configuration matrix are documented here:

runbook for badug-kadup: https://confluence.zemvarlabs.internal/projects/browse/display/projects/bd1b

# Resizing assets

All batch image resizing goes through the squintly CLI. Do not resize manually. Install it from the Darrow package mirror, run `squintly init`, and point it at the asset bucket your lead assigns. Default output is WebP at three breakpoints; override only with approval. Jobs over 500 images must run on the batch host, not your laptop. Full flag reference and examples live on the internal page.

wiki page, tahaf-tajog: https://jira.ordindyn.corp/pipeline

PickPath Optimizer: restart procedure. If pick-list generation stalls at the Verlan depot, drain the queue via the admin console before restarting the optimizer pod. Do not restart mid-batch; partial lists confuse the floor scanners. After restart, confirm the scheduler resumes within two minutes. When filing the incident note, include the token shown directly below this paragraph.

build token for kagaf-hahof: htk14_9d3d4d26d7d8de